From 2c8779736a137d4bb0187c43d6e118d74d2d34b9 Mon Sep 17 00:00:00 2001 From: Nick Sweeting Date: Tue, 17 Sep 2024 02:03:28 -0700 Subject: [PATCH] change default node version to 21 --- .../ansible/roles/setup_lib_npm/tasks/main.yml | 5 ----- .../ansible/roles/setup_lib_npm/vars/main.yml | 2 +- archivebox/builtin_plugins/puppeteer/install_puppeteer.yml | 1 + 3 files changed, 2 insertions(+), 6 deletions(-) diff --git a/archivebox/builtin_plugins/ansible/roles/setup_lib_npm/tasks/main.yml b/archivebox/builtin_plugins/ansible/roles/setup_lib_npm/tasks/main.yml index 8a4591c3..4e858b61 100755 --- a/archivebox/builtin_plugins/ansible/roles/setup_lib_npm/tasks/main.yml +++ b/archivebox/builtin_plugins/ansible/roles/setup_lib_npm/tasks/main.yml @@ -55,11 +55,6 @@ name: "nodejs={{ TARGET_NODE_VERSION | regex_replace('x', '') }}*" state: present -- name: "Install system packages: npm" - ansible.builtin.package: - name: "npm" - state: "present" - - name: Load NPM and Node binaries include_role: name: load_binary diff --git a/archivebox/builtin_plugins/ansible/roles/setup_lib_npm/vars/main.yml b/archivebox/builtin_plugins/ansible/roles/setup_lib_npm/vars/main.yml index c528c906..9ad00c1e 100644 --- a/archivebox/builtin_plugins/ansible/roles/setup_lib_npm/vars/main.yml +++ b/archivebox/builtin_plugins/ansible/roles/setup_lib_npm/vars/main.yml @@ -5,6 +5,6 @@ LIB_DIR_BIN: '{{LIB_DIR}}/bin' LIB_DIR_NPM: '{{LIB_DIR}}/npm' LIB_DIR_NPM_BIN: '{{LIB_DIR_NPM}}/node_modules/.bin' -TARGET_NODE_VERSION: '22' +TARGET_NODE_VERSION: '21' MIN_NODE_VERSION: '20.0.0' MIN_NPM_VERSION: '10.0.0' diff --git a/archivebox/builtin_plugins/puppeteer/install_puppeteer.yml b/archivebox/builtin_plugins/puppeteer/install_puppeteer.yml index 6085952c..d277685b 100755 --- a/archivebox/builtin_plugins/puppeteer/install_puppeteer.yml +++ b/archivebox/builtin_plugins/puppeteer/install_puppeteer.yml @@ -14,6 +14,7 @@ - include_role: name: setup_lib_npm vars: + TARGET_NODE_VERSION: '21' MIN_NODE_VERSION: '20.0.0' MIN_NPM_VERSION: '10.0.0'